Output ecb66ab66fd3c6a11879908acc1daf642ff1d97d0c1bdaee2ca29a0893f71e03:0

value
130703736
script pubkey
OP_0 OP_PUSHBYTES_20 e64b4806007814d01d60ae9f71dbc436891c451a
address
bc1que95spsq0q2dq8tq460hrk7yx6y3c3g62zyelk
transaction
ecb66ab66fd3c6a11879908acc1daf642ff1d97d0c1bdaee2ca29a0893f71e03
spent
true